China’delivered “stealth fighter” radar YLC-8B to Iran

According to a report by the “Al-Dafah Al-Arabi” website, China has delivered the advanced YLC-8 radar to Iran; a radar known as a “stealth aircraft hunter” due to its anti-radar evasion capabilities and considered a serious threat to fifth-generation fighters such as the F-22 and F-35.

The most important features of this radar are:

Working in the low-frequency UHF band, which creates resonance in the fuselage of stealth aircraft, rendering their anti-radar coating ineffective.

Air target detection range up to 500 km and ballistic missile tracking range up to 700 km

The ability to direct defensive fire with high precision, unlike old radars that only detected.

Mobile and strategic design mounted on heavy trailers with a massive 140 square meter retractable antenna for quick relocation

Military experts believe that the delivery of this radar to Iran is one of the most important recent developments in the field of regional air defense and could severely weaken the air superiority of Western and Israeli stealth fighters against Iranian defense systems.
